1 <?xml version="1.0" encoding="UTF-8"?>
2 <!-- Intel(R) Active Management Technology NetworkTime Interface version 1.15.1-->
4 xmlns="http://schemas.xmlsoap.org/wsdl/"
5 xmlns:wsdl="http://schemas.xmlsoap.org/wsdl/"
6 xmlns:soap="http://schemas.xmlsoap.org/wsdl/soap/"
7 xmlns:xs="http://www.w3.org/2001/XMLSchema"
8 xmlns:tim="http://schemas.intel.com/platform/client/NetworkTime/2004/01"
9 targetNamespace="http://schemas.intel.com/platform/client/NetworkTime/2004/01">
11 <xs:schema targetNamespace="http://schemas.intel.com/platform/client/NetworkTime/2004/01" elementFormDefault="qualified">
13 <xs:simpleType name="PT_STATUS">
14 <xs:restriction base="xs:unsignedInt"/>
16 <xs:simpleType name="TimeType">
17 <xs:restriction base="xs:unsignedInt"/>
20 <xs:element name="GetLowAccuracyTimeSynch">
26 <xs:element name="GetLowAccuracyTimeSynchResponse">
29 <xs:element name="StatusCode" type="tim:PT_STATUS"/>
30 <xs:element name="Ta0" type="tim:TimeType"/>
35 <xs:element name="SetHighAccuracyTimeSynch">
38 <xs:element name="Ta0" type="tim:TimeType"/>
39 <xs:element name="Tm1" type="tim:TimeType"/>
40 <xs:element name="Tm2" type="tim:TimeType"/>
44 <xs:element name="SetHighAccuracyTimeSynchResponse">
47 <xs:element name="StatusCode" type="tim:PT_STATUS"/>
55 <message name="GetLowAccuracyTimeSynchIn">
56 <part name="parameters" element="tim:GetLowAccuracyTimeSynch"/>
58 <message name="GetLowAccuracyTimeSynchOut">
59 <part name="parameters" element="tim:GetLowAccuracyTimeSynchResponse"/>
61 <message name="SetHighAccuracyTimeSynchIn">
62 <part name="parameters" element="tim:SetHighAccuracyTimeSynch"/>
64 <message name="SetHighAccuracyTimeSynchOut">
65 <part name="parameters" element="tim:SetHighAccuracyTimeSynchResponse"/>
68 <portType name="NetworkTimeSoapPortType">
70 <operation name="GetLowAccuracyTimeSynch">
71 <input message="tim:GetLowAccuracyTimeSynchIn"/>
72 <output message="tim:GetLowAccuracyTimeSynchOut"/>
74 <operation name="SetHighAccuracyTimeSynch">
75 <input message="tim:SetHighAccuracyTimeSynchIn"/>
76 <output message="tim:SetHighAccuracyTimeSynchOut"/>
81 <binding name="NetworkTimeSoapBinding" type="tim:NetworkTimeSoapPortType">
82 <soap:binding style="document" transport="http://schemas.xmlsoap.org/soap/http"/>
84 <operation name="GetLowAccuracyTimeSynch">
85 <soap:operation soapAction="http://schemas.intel.com/platform/client/NetworkTime/2004/01/GetLowAccuracyTimeSynch" style="document"/>
87 <soap:body use="literal"/>
90 <soap:body use="literal"/>
93 <operation name="SetHighAccuracyTimeSynch">
94 <soap:operation soapAction="http://schemas.intel.com/platform/client/NetworkTime/2004/01/SetHighAccuracyTimeSynch" style="document"/>
96 <soap:body use="literal"/>
99 <soap:body use="literal"/>
105 <service name="NetworkTimeService">
106 <port name="NetworkTimeSoapPortType" binding="tim:NetworkTimeSoapBinding">
107 <soap:address location="http://hostname:16992/NetworkTimeService"/>